Analysis

W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d) recorded 42,558 for inbound internationally mobile students from africa, both sexes in 2023. That is the highest value across all 22 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 7.1% on the previous year and up 161.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, inbound internationally mobile students from africa, both sexes in W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d) peaked at 42,558 in 2023 and was at its lowest, 11,545, in 2002.

That places W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d) 102nd out of 205 groups with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.

Inbound internationally mobile students from Africa, both sexes in W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d), year by year

Annual values for Inbound internationally mobile students from Africa, both sexes (number) in W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d), 2002 to 2023.
Year Value Change
2002 11,545
2003 11,825 +2.4%
2004 12,963 +9.6%
2005 13,500 +4.1%
2006 14,962 +10.8%
2007 15,465 +3.4%
2008 16,169 +4.6%
2009 17,514 +8.3%
2010 18,139 +3.6%
2011 17,225 -5.0%
2012 16,475 -4.4%
2013 16,308 -1.0%
2014 25,455 +56.1%
2015 27,338 +7.4%
2016 28,746 +5.2%
2017 31,198 +8.5%
2018 31,033 -0.5%
2019 34,605 +11.5%
2020 37,946 +9.7%
2021 37,918 -0.1%
2022 39,733 +4.8%
2023 42,558 +7.1%
